CBSE Board Exam Result 2017: Wait for students who appeared for CBSE examination 2017, CBSE 10th Board Result, Central Board of Secondary Education Result will be over soon.

This year the CBSE Class 10 exam was held between March 9 to April 10. Results in all 10 regions will be announced simultaneously.

In 2016, 14,91,293 appeared for Class X examination, out of which 96.21% students cleared 10th examination with flying colours. 

In a major relief to students, the Central Board of Secondary Education (CBSE) will not move the SC to challenge the Delhi High Court instructions stating that evaluation for the class 10 and 12 board exams this year should be done as per the grace marks policy. Aiming to check high cut-offs in colleges, the CBSE had scrapped the moderation policy under which grace marks are given to the students in exams for difficult questions.

Details about Central Board of Secondary Education (CBSE):

The Central Board of Secondary Education was reconstituted in the year 1962 with the main objectives "to serve the educational institutions more effectively, to be responsive to the educational needs of those students whose parents were employed in the central government and had frequently transferable jobs."

As a result of the reconstitution, the erstwhile 'Delhi Board of Secondary Education' was merged with the Central Board and thus all the educational institutions recognised by the Delhi Board also became a part of the Central Board. Subsequently, all the schools located in the Union Territory of Chandigarh. Andaman and Nicobar Island, Arunachal Pradesh, the state of Sikkim, and now Jharkhand, Uttaranchal and Chhattisgarh have also got affiliation with the Board.

How to check CBSE 10th Results:

1.  Log on to either of the official websites: cbse.nic.incbseresults.nic.in,

2. Click on the tab highlighted “CBSE X Board Results 2017 (All Regions)”

3. Keep information like roll number handy to access CBSE Board Result 2017

4. Take a printout of the result for future reference.

Candidates are advised to collect the official mark sheets from their respective institutes.
